A new 12 step meeting on substance abuse is being planned for the chat rooms. It is tentatively being planned for Thursdays 5 pm EST and will be moderated by chat moderator ChefChristina.

If anyone is interested in attending such a meeting, please indicate by posting below or you may contact Stu(princecharmless) and/or Christina for additional details.

Remember, Chat rooms including the AA/NA recovery room require a separate registration to participate.

If you have a pattern of substance abuse and would like to stop, it might greatly benefit you to attend these meetings.

This meeting is in addition to the Sunday night 9pm EST meeting that has existed for years. It does not replace it.

BEFORE Sunday at 9 PM Eastern Time, go over to the Chat Site and register there if you have not. The Mods over there will give you a brief interview and give you some info on how chat works, and unless you tell them you are an admirer or are looking for Date-A-Trans, there will be no problem passing the interview and being welcome.

If another mod has not interviewed you before you come to the Substance Abuse AA/NA chat room, either I or Charlize (who are the room moderators) will do it for you so the head chat administrator does not get on our necks. For me on the left coast the start time is 6PM PDT, and on the right coast it is 9 PM EDT with times in between as you go from west to east.

We are pretty loose there as far as what we do talk about, and if everybody there is clean and sober that night, and not having any cravings or problems, we talk Trans* stuff, or just tell good stories and bad jokes. That can shift direction fast if someone who is hurting and craving comes in, and that becomes an urgent focus. The chat is an hour and a half, but both Charlize and I, and even the others go over time if a sister or brother needs it.

      Nostalgia is an emotion. It is the feeling of enjoying events from the past. People with nostalgia will often look at or use old things that they were familiar with years ago. This is because people feel more connected to those past times that they enjoyed, usually because it reminds them of how long it has been since they last connected to such past times. Examples where people may have the feeling of nostalgia includes watching old TV shows, using old technology that was very enjoyable, and playing with toys that you played with as a child. These memories are usually misleading, and can make someone wish that they could be young again, even if their childhood was mediocre. Human brains often leave out boring or bad memories, which can cause incorrect feelings about their childhood.

      CAT FACTS A cat's jaw cannot move sideways. The only domestic animal not mentioned in the Bible is the cat   A house cat’s genome is 95.6 percent tiger, and they share many behaviors with their jungle ancestors, says Layla Morgan Wilde, a cat behavior expert and the founder of Cat Wisdom 101. These behaviors include scent marking by scratching, prey play, prey stalking, pouncing, chinning, and urine marking. Cats are believed to be the only mammals who don’t taste sweetness. Cats are nearsighted, but their peripheral vision and night vision are much better than that of humans. Cats are supposed to have 18 toes (five toes on each front paw; four toes on each back paw). Cats can jump up to six times their length. Cats’ claws all curve downward, which means that they can’t climb down trees head-first. Instead, they have to back down the trunk. Cats’ collarbones don’t connect to their other bones, as these bones are buried in their shoulder muscles. Cats have 230 bones, while humans only have 206. Cats have an extra organ that allows them to taste scents on the air, which is why your cat stares at you with her mouth open from time to time. Cats have whiskers on the backs of their front legs, as well. Cats have nearly twice the amount of neurons in their cerebral cortex as dogs. Cats have the largest eyes relative to their head size of any mammal. Cats make very little noise when they walk around. The thick, soft pads on their paws allow them to sneak up on their prey — or you! Cats’ rough tongues can lick a bone clean of any shred of meat. Cats use their long tails to balance themselves when they’re jumping or walking along narrow ledges. Cats use their whiskers to “feel” the world around them in an effort to determine which small spaces they can fit into. A cat’s whiskers are generally about the same width as its body. (This is why you should never, EVER cut their whiskers.) Cats walk like camels and giraffes: They move both of their right feet first, then move both of their left feet. No other animals walk this way. Male cats are more likely to be left-pawed, while female cats are more likely to be right-pawed. Though cats can notice the fast movements of their prey, it often seems to them that slow-moving objects are actually stagnant. Some cats are ambidextrous, but 40 percent are either left- or right-pawed. Some cats can swim. There are cats who have more than 18 toes. These extra-digit felines are referred to as being “polydactyl.”
